bath squirts
455 results
for “bath squirts”$41.99
reg $103.48
Sale
$45.99
reg $113.94
Sale
$51.99
reg $129.90
Sale
$47.99 - $51.99
reg $119.42 - $129.38
Sale
Sponsored
$67.99
reg $169.90
Sale
$67.99
reg $169.90
Sale
$71.99
reg $179.18
Sale
Sponsored